The Speed Art Museum is partnering with the Festival of Faiths to host a lecture by Dr. John A. Grim on the theme of air in Native-American religious traditions. Dr. Grim is currently a Senior Lecturer and Senior Research Scholar at Yale University, teaching courses that draw students from the School of Forestry & Environmental Studies, Yale Divinity School, the Department of Religious Studies, the Institution for Social and Policy Studies, and the Yale Colleges.
The lecture will be presented in conjunction with the exhibition Sacred Air, Breath of Life: Selections from the Native-American Collection.
